The Strokes
The Strokes are an American rock and roll band hailing from New York City. The group consists of Julian Casablancas, Nick Valensi, Albert Hammond Jr., Nikolai Fraiture and Fabrizio Moretti. The group formed in New York City and gained fame for their live shows. The Modern Age (EP) was released in 2001 and sparked a bidding war among record labels. The Strokes released their debut album Is This It in the U.S. in October 2001 on RCA. They released their sophomore album Room on Fire in October 2003.Along with other New York City-based rock bands, the Strokes helped to launch a revival of a post-punk, "stripped-down" and raw sound, continuing in the tradition of the Velvet Underground, Television and the Ramones.
